Hey.

The cut off for admission in government colleges in Rajasthan  under the State quota for the SC category in the previous year 2018 was a rank of 40997 and a score of 457 marks. The cut off changes each year due to several factors like level of difficulty or level of Competition etc. This year as the paper was easier the cut off based on marks will be higher than before. Considering your score, and the previous year last score you seem to have less chance of Admission here.
